NLACRC Budget

The Department of Developmental Services (DDS) provides funding for services and supports through state-operated developmental centers and contracts with the 21 regional centers. The NLACRC budget is largely dependent upon the funds available in the State budget.

Regional centers are required by law to provide services in the most cost-effective way possible. They must use all other resources, including generic resources, before using any regional center funds. A generic resource is a service provided by an agency that has a legal responsibility to provide services to the general public and receives public funds for providing those services.

Some generic agencies you might be referred to are the local school district, county social services department, Medi-Cal, Social Security Administration, Department of Rehabilitation and others. Other resources may include natural supports. This is help that you may get from family, friends or others at little or no cost.
